Web25 Mar 2024 · In this article, we report four experimental studies to explore the impact that such an evaluation system has on unethical behavior. We find that participants under relative performance evaluation expect others to be more likely to use unethical means (Study 1) and indulge more in unethical behavior themselves (Study 2). Web19 Oct 2024 · Ethics. Unethical workplace behavior is any action at work that goes against the prevailing moral norms of a community. At work, unethical behavior can take multiple forms and have multiple targets. From minor to severe forms, everyone can behave unethically, hurting societies, organizations, colleagues, and even the self in the process.
